Job Description

Work Schedule and Location:

  • During the initial six-month training period, this position requires working 100% onsite, Monday to Friday, at our Heredia Shared Service Center, and upon successful completion of the training period, employees will transition to a hybrid work model. 

  • A standard schedule of 7:00 AM to 4:00 PM is required for the first 4 months. Working hours may also vary after the 4 months between 5:00 AM and 8:00 PM, depending on business requirements and operational coverage.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ide outstanding customer service in invoicing, administration, order management, quotations, and master data.

  • Handle partner concerns and complex customer requirements, working strictly within guidelines and collaborating with sales, distribution, and finance teams to resolve issues.

  • Become proficient in Customer Relationship Management systems.

  • Adhere to company policies, operational regulations, and training guidelines.

  • Meet key performance indicators and engage in initiatives to improve efficiency and productivity.

  • Contribute to projects and assignments that align with business expectations.

  • Maintain high data accuracy and quality, and participate in training development.

  • Use daily customer service reports to assess and direct activities.

  • Participate in cross-training and support activities during peak seasons.

Skills:

  • High integrity and compliance.

  • Strong problem-solving and multitasking abilities.

  • Self-motivated, enthusiastic, and a great teammate.

  • Proficient written and verbal communication.

  • Excellent organizational skills and workload prioritization.

  • Initiative in daily tasks and problem-solving.

  • Proficient Microsoft Office user.

Experience:

  • 0+ years of customer service experience in an SSC/multinational environment required.

Education:

  • Minimum of a high school diploma.

Working Conditions:

  • Repetitive typing and regular computer use.

  • Typical office environment physical demands.

Thermo Fisher Scientific is a global leader in serving science, providing a wide range of analytical instruments, reagents, and software solutions for healthcare, pharmaceuticals, and life sciences research. With a commitment to innovation and quality, the company enables customers to make significant advancements in scientific discovery and healthcare diagnostics. Thermo Fisher operates in more than 50 countries and employs over 80,000 people, fostering a collaborative environment aimed at enhancing global health and safety. Through its broad portfolio of brands and technologies, the company plays a vital role in accelerating life-changing research and improving patient outcomes worldwide.
